#7d3218 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d3218 is composed of 49% red, 19.6%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60% magenta, 80.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 15.4 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 29.2%. #7d3218 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a6430 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#7d3218 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#7d3218 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d3218 has RGB values of R:125, G:50,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.81,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8204824.

Shades and Tints of #7d3218
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0402 is the darkest color, while #fefa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d3218
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4846 is the less saturated color, while #942701 is the most saturated one.
